    After a completed print the rear fan stays on. I know the fan on the print head should stay on, but the rear fan will not shut off after printing. Any way of adjusting the code to shut it off after printing?

    Rear fan?

    There are 4 fans on the robo.

    1) One on the extruder (the extruder fan)
    2) One on the X carriage that blows on the printed parts (the parts fan)
    3) One under the printer that cools the Ramps/Arduino (we will call that the RAMPS fan)
    4) one on/in the power supply.

    The only one of those that should ever be off with the printer on is the parts fan.
    You can edit the ending GCode to add a code to turn it off if you slicer does not already do that for you
    This should do it:

    M106 S0
